Noting that there was a failing unit test in the split mesh-to-grid regrid (lib/ugants/tests/regrid/applications/test_integration.py::TestConsistentResults::test_no_tolerance[bilinear-4]). Difference plot attached (expected - actual):

diffplot

Expected: global-to-global mesh-to-grid regrid.
Actual: split-regrid-recombine mesh-to-grid regrid, with 4 bands.
Both using bilinear method.

There are a bunch of masked points (the white points in the plot), which appear masked in both the expected and actual (due to SciTools/iris-esmf-regrid#391, now fixed in later versions of iris-esmf-regrid). There are also a few points where there are actual differences.

As a result I have decided to increase the source data resolution for this test from C4 to C12 (splitting a C4 into 4 bands is a fairly unrealistic test of our banded regrid): 302a055
